Andre is a big, snuggly bottle baby puppy. He currently weighs about 20 pounds! He has short stocky legs like a dwarf or Basset Hound or Corgi. He has huge paws, and soft wiry fur like an Otter Hound or Wire hair Terrier. Because he is a bottle baby, we really have no idea what breed mix he is. He is blonde and white. He loves to be held and is calm when snuggling. While he does have a lazy side, when he wants to he loves to run and play. Don't be surprised though that if you take him for a long walk, that he will want to be carried home.
Andre likes cats and gets along well with them, but unfortunatly w suspect he might have a cat allergy though, as the only time he coughs is when he is around cats. He got sick and had a high fever and needed to be on antibiotics as a result of his suspected cat allergy, so he needs a home with no cats.
He gets along with other dogs and puppies. He plays a little rough, so looking for a home without young children.

Cats are tested for FIV/FeLV, vaccinated, spayed or neutered, dewormed, and microchipped. Cat adoptions are inside only and no declawing.
Dogs are vaccinated, spayed or neutered, dewormed, microchipped, heartworm tested, and on Heartworm prevention. We don't adopt out yard or chain dogs. Dog adopters must have a fenced in yard.
Small animals are vetted. Ferrets are vaccinated and on Revolution for heartworm and flea prevention. Rabbits are spayed/neutered and exams done. Guinea pigs receive an exam. All pets are treated for parasites as needed.

The Acadiana Humane Society is a small foster home organization. Our goal is to safe as many lives of dogs and cats as we can and also to educate and inform the public about animal rescue. We totally rely on the generosity of our community to help us with our work. We're only funded by donations and adoption fees for the saved animals.
You can find us every Saturday from 12:00Noon to 04:00 pm at Petco in Lafayette with dogs, cats, and small animals available for adoption. You also can find our pets on our webpage @ http://www.acadianahumane.org and also http://www.mycatranch.com
Our regular cat adoption fee is $100.00. Our regular dog adoption fee is $150.00. Purebred cats are $150.00. Purebred dogs are $200.00. Guinea Pigs are $20,00. Spayed Rabbits are $50.00. Spayed/descented Ferrets are $75.00. This includes all tests, vaccinations, deworming, and spay/neuter of the animal. Our requirements for dogs are: fenced in backyard, no chain or yard dogs. Our requirements for cats are: inside only and NO declawing or tendenectomy.
